Why did the time left on the countdown increase after I placed a bid?
Once a user places a new bid, we want to give other users a chance to counterbid, which is where the haggling comes in. The time added to the countdown can be as little as 10 seconds but it is never more than 2 minutes per bid.

Is there a limit on the number of auctions I can win?
Yes. You are limited to winning up to 2 auctions in a 14 day rolling period. For example, if you win a product on May 1, and another on May 4, the earliest you can bid to win a 3rd product is May 15 (May 1 + 14 days). The earliest you can bid to win a 4th product is May 18 (May 4 + 14 days)
 
What if I have won 2 auctions in 14 days, but I have already bid on other auctions before reaching the 2 auction limit?
You will not be able to continue bidding on auctions you’ve already placed bids on before reaching the 2 win limit. You will not be able to bid on other auctions until the 14 day rolling period has passed. All bid butler and single bids placed on auctions before reaching the 2 win limit will be deleted. All used bids are non refundable.

Bid Butler
 
What is Bid Butler?
Bid Butler is a feature that will intelligently bid on your behalf, based on the parameters you enter. You choose the minimum price, maximum price and the maximum number of bids you are willing to use. Unused bids on your bid butler will be returned to your account.
 
How do I use a Bid Butler?
When you select a specific product, the bid butler feature will be displayed right under the product counter. You can then choose the “minimum price”, “maximum price” and “number of bids to use”.
 
What happens if there is multiple Bid Butler’s bidding for the same auction?
All Bid Butler’s will take turns bidding. They will not bid unless someone places a higher bid than they placed. Bid Butler will only bid until they reach their maximum limit or until they run out of bids.

Buy it Now (Future Feature)
 
How does the ‘Buy it Now’ feature work?
The 'Buy it Now' feature will allow users to not leave an auction empty handed. Users can purchase the product using the value of the bids they have spent on that product. Please note that the base prices for buy it now will be 15% higher than the retail price Ehaggler have been given. When a user selects this option, they pay the balance between the base buy it now price and the value of the bids they will have already spent. Keep in mind that the buy now price will never be below zero, even if the value of the bids a user has spent are more than the retail value of the product.
 
Can a user continue bidding if they use the ‘Buy it Now’ option?
Unfortunately not. Once a user has chosen to buy the product they are no longer eligible to continue bidding on it. Any bid butler bids that have been placed on the product will be cancelled and unused bids will be returned to the relevant   account. Likewise, the auction winner will not be permitted to use the ‘Buy it Now’ feature.
 
How long does a user have to use the ‘Buy it Now’ option?
This function will be available from the time the auction begins right up to 24 hours after it closes. Once a user selects this option they will have 24 hours to pay for the product.

What if the timer reaches zero and nothing appears to happen?
There are a few possible explanations:

·          The connection between your computer and the Ehaggler servers could be broken.

·          If the connection is broken, the timer on your computer will continue to count down because it has not received the signal from the Ehaggler servers to reset the timer.

·          The browser you are using might have exhausted its resources.

·          Unlike typical websites that download a page once, our site constantly communicates with the servers to receive bids and manage the auction timers. Older versions of internet browsers or browsers with numerous plugins may freeze after hosting the site for a long time. We suggest using the latest internet browsers and reducing the number of plugins or add ons.
